Detainee caused fire at Immigration Removal Centre, Dover, resulting in two being injured

By: Beth Robson

Published: 00:00, 14 January 2015

Updated: 09:26, 14 January 2015

An inmate is suspected of causing a fire at Dover Immigration Removal Centre, which resulted in two injuries.

Kent Fire and Rescue Service was called at 7pm last night to the centre on Dover's Western Heights.

A spokeswoman said: "We were called by when we arrived the fire was out so we didn't need to do anything."

Two appliances were sent from Dover Fire Station.

The stop call was sent at 7.22pm. Firefighters remained to help with ventilation.
